ABSTRACT

Urban microclimate research focuses on thermal comfort and microclimate effect, while empirical research on microclimate design considering summer and winter is limited. Taking the Kuiyuan community in Xuzhou as an example, ENVI-met was used to analyze the microclimate elements (air temperature, wind speed and humidity) and the characteristics of human thermal comfort PMV. Based on this, the utilization value of the site was judged, and the means of landscape renewal was proposed. Finally, the microclimate changes before and after landscape renewal were compared. It was found that the microclimate elements and thermal comfort were improved to varying degrees, which verified the feasibility and practical value of the landscape renewal strategy. This research provides a way to guide landscape design strategies through intuitive simulation data analysis.
